1. Create a Calm and Comfortable Space for Healing
Cats going through FIP treatment need plenty of rest. They may feel weak, sensitive to noise, or easily stressed.
A quiet, comfortable environment helps your cat stay calm and recover better.
What you can do:
Prepare a warm, peaceful resting area
Reduce loud sounds, visitors, and sudden movements
Keep other pets from disturbing your cat
Use soft bedding or a heated pad
Maintain a steady daily routine
A relaxed cat is a healing cat — comfort plays a big role in recovery.

3. Monitor Your Cat’s Daily Progress
Daily observation helps you understand how well your cat is responding to treatment. Even small changes can be meaningful and help your vet or support team give better guidance.
Monitor these daily:
Appetite and water intake
Weight
Litter box habits
Activity level and mobility
Breathing
Temperature
Any neurological signs (wobbling, head tilt, tremors)
Use a notebook, phone app, or simple checklist. This helps when reporting updates to BasmiFIP™ or your veterinarian.
4. Follow the Treatment Schedule Consistently
GS-441524 works best when given every 24 hours at the same time.
Consistency is one of the most important factors for successful FIP treatment.
How to stay consistent:
Set an alarm or reminder
Give the injection at the exact same time daily
Write down each dose
Avoid changing the dosage without guidance
A stable treatment routine ensures the antiviral works effectively and helps your cat recover faster.
